Work description
The aim of this project is the provision of a new modern, sustainable two storey building for Kidbrooke Park Primary School offering high quality educational facilities. BREEAM excellent is the target for the school.The building scope is that of BB103 2-Form Entry School (30 students per class) with 26-place Nursery and 18-place Learning Centre, with no current expansion proposed. This reduces the impact of the school on the site and surrounding properties, due to its reduced footprint. The projects landscaping objectives include the main school entrance being located off Holburne Road as well as 14 car parking spaces and 2 disabled parking spaces, a new outdoor Multi-Use Games Area (MUGA) available for community use in and out of school hours. A pupil entrance from Kellaway Road, and 69 cycle parking spaces for pupils, staff and visitors. The project should be delivered in an environment which represents best practice and supports a focus on educational improvement. The project should be delivered in accordance with the Master Programme.
